Värmbols GoIF was a sports club from Katrineholm, a town in Sweden. It started way back in 1927. This club was special because it had teams for two different sports: soccer and bandy. Bandy is a winter sport played on ice, a bit like ice hockey but with different rules and a ball instead of a puck.

Bandy Team's Success
The men's bandy team was quite good. They even played in the top league in Sweden, called the Swedish top division, in 1931 and 1932. This was a big achievement for the club! Overall, the men's bandy team played in the top division for seven seasons. That's a lot of time competing against the best teams in the country.
Soccer Teams' Journey
Värmbols GoIF also had soccer teams. The women's soccer team played in the Swedish third division during the 1980s. This shows they were a strong team, competing at a high level. The men's soccer team also played in the Swedish third division in 1975 and 1976. Both teams worked hard and represented their club well.
The Club's New Beginning
After many years, Värmbols GoIF decided to change. On December 3, 1990, the club split into three new, separate clubs. This allowed each sport to have its own dedicated club.
- Värmbols FC was created for the men's soccer team.
- DFK Värmbol became the new home for the women's soccer team.
- Värmbol-Katrineholm BK was formed for the bandy team.
